Output 65db30ca3deb4195f331e1166f5bbfc7aa715054bcef949d85fb9a2c7aa9e339:1

value
539000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54706e565df99d1fcfb8ce8e5e32cf3043c37354 OP_EQUALVERIFY OP_CHECKSIG
address
18hUSxWD3YDLzYEv7qpG6ZTBhEXof3YbhE
transaction
65db30ca3deb4195f331e1166f5bbfc7aa715054bcef949d85fb9a2c7aa9e339
spent
true